Endgame

von Nancy Garden

MitgliederRezensionenBeliebtheitDurchschnittliche BewertungDiskussionen
18711145,225 (3.82)24
Fifteen-year-old Gray Wilton, bullied at school and ridiculed by an unfeeling father for preferring drums to hunting, goes on a shooting rampage at his high school.

Fourteen year old Gray Wilton just wants to play his drums, create songs, play with his dog, and be left alone. Unfortunately, Gray doesn't ever get what he wants. His dad hates him, his mother is too scared of his father to offer support, and his big brother Peter is too perfect and too busy to notice. Zorro, the school's football hero and his pack of friends make Gray's life miserable by bullying him mercilessly. As seems to be too typically true, no one listens or cares as his life spirals and his grades spiral downwards. Neither his parents, teachers, guidance counselor or principal pay attention to obvious clues about what's been happening. Only Gray's dog and drums keep him afloat in his misery.

Knowing he'll get away with it Zorro destroys Gray's drums, kills his dog and continues to torture him until Gray feels there's only one thing he can do. He gets his father's gun and goes to school for revenge. Unfortunately, the revenge Gray seeks and the relief he thinks he will get are not what actually happen. As usual, Gray doesn't ever get what he wants. ( )
